首页
教程
问答社区
new
标签库
开发文档
最新
工具箱
立即登录
免费注册
扫码关注官方微信
扫码下载APP
返回顶部
首页
>
标签库
>
HAL
当前位置:#HAL#
扫描二维码
关注官方微信号获取第一手资料
Python
2023-01-31
Android
HAL
开发 (3)
在上一篇文章中我们分析了jni的led service代码,该代码通过调用led的HAL层代码,实现了mokoid_init, mokoid_setOn, mokoid_setOff三个C/C++接口,但是该接口还无法直接提供给java程序...
440
标签:
Android
HAL
移动开发
2022-06-06
Ubuntu中为Android简单介绍硬件抽象层(
HAL
)
Android的硬件抽象层,简单来说,就是对Linux内核驱动程序的封装,向上提供接口,屏蔽低层的实现细节。 对硬件的支持分成了两层,一层放在用户空间(User Space),一层放在内核空间(Ker...
131
标签:
hal
ubuntu
抽象
硬件抽象层
Android
移动开发
2022-06-06
Ubuntu中为Android
HAL
编写JNI方法提供JAVA访问硬件服务接口
在上两篇文章中,我们介绍了如何为Android系统的硬件编写驱动程序,包括如何在Linux内核空间实现内核驱动程序和在用户空间实现硬件抽象层接口。实现这两者的目的是为了向更上一层提供硬件访问接口,即为Android的Application...
298
标签:
ubuntu
JAVA
jni
hal
接口
Android
操作系统
2022-06-06
Ubuntu中为Android增加硬件抽象层(
HAL
)模块访问Linux内核驱动程序
在Ubuntu Android简单介绍硬件抽象层(HAL)一文中,我们简要介绍了在Android系统为为硬件编写驱动程序的方法。简单来说,硬件驱动程序一方面分布在Linux内核中,另一方面分布在用户空间的硬件抽象层中。接着Ub...
459
标签:
hal
ubuntu
Linux
程序
模块
抽象
硬件抽象层
Android
移动开发
2022-06-06
[Android][frameworks][HIDL]使用HIDL新建虚拟
HAL
以实现system_server与native进程双向通信(一)——服务端
前言 需求是这样的,system_server有一个LocalService,需要向一个具有root权限的native进程进行消息传递(下发请求指令,获取状态信息等)评估 首先附上官方介绍:https://source.android.co...
287
标签:
hal
服务端
native
通信
system
Android
移动开发
2022-06-06
[Android][frameworks][HIDL]使用HIDL新建虚拟
HAL
以实现system_server与native进程双向通信(二)——踩坑篇
前言 在上一篇中,我们已经搭建好了服务端的代码结构,并且保证编译通过; 但是由于各种坑的存在,我们无法直接让服务端跑起来,因此本篇不是写客户端调用,而是一篇和编译规则定义、selinux规则添加等相关的踩坑总集,如果你已经保证服务端已经跑起...
829
标签:
hal
native
通信
system
Android
移动开发
2022-06-06
[Android][frameworks][HIDL]使用HIDL新建虚拟
HAL
以实现system_server与native进程双向通信(三)——JAVA客户端
前言 在上一篇中已经完成了服务端的集成,手机软件此时已经可以自动启动服务端,且运行无异常。 接下来我们就要实现我们的终极目标了:system_server(JAVA端)与服务端相互通信; 预处理 首先先解释下一个“玄学”的情况:在前两章的操...
309
标签:
hal
JAVA
native
通信
system
Android
热门文章
Android:VolumeShaper
2022-06-06
Oracle Study--Oracle RAC CacheFusion(MindMap)
2024-04-02
Python 学习之路 - Python
2023-01-31
报表SQL
2024-04-02
[mysql]mysql8修改root密码
2020-03-03
MySQL专题3之MySQL管理
2023-01-31
精彩推荐
1
oracle ceil函数的使用方法是什么
2
香港免备案服务器租用的优势有哪些
3
换主机空间对SEO有什么影响
4
虚拟主机的优点是什么
5
如何判断香港服务器机房好不好
6
怎么挑选香港虚拟主机
7
站长为什么喜欢租用香港免备案主机
8
免备案服务器租用如何选择
9
如何判断网站是否遭受ddos攻击
10
PHP设计模式:自动化和工具支持
标签
更多
服务器
阿里
java
故障
报错
亚马逊
数据库
linux
腾讯
oracle
sql
开发语言
number
vue
c++
win10
spring
华为
云服务器
c语言
密码
账号
系统
html
win7
C#
运维
springboot
方法
ubuntu
虚拟主机
网络
mongodb
端口
多少钱
vps
香港服务器
功能
区别
美国服务器
mybatis
好用
pycharm
域名
小程序
云主机
类型
怎么回事
boot
macos
文件
by
navicat
前端
css3
go
地址
便宜
Powered
金山文档
返回顶部